Saina Nehwal Says India Must Top Medal Tally to Be Sporting Nation
Former world No. 1 shuttler Saina Nehwal emphasized that India must rank among the top nations in medal tallies to be recognized as a true sporting nation. Speaking at St Xavier's College's 'Malhar' festival, she highlighted progress in women's sports, especially in states like Haryana, and stressed the need for early financial support, better promotion, and improved psychological and physical resources for athletes across disciplines to nurture more champions.
